Weingut Kublin
Weingut Kublin is a small Baden, Kaiserstuhl winery in Endingen-Königschaffhausen, founded in 1992 and shaped around a personal tasting-room scale rather than a large visitor circuit. The range spans Pinot Blanc, Pinot Gris, Pinot Noir, Chardonnay, Muscat and Müller-Thurgau, giving travelers a compact view of Kaiserstuhl wine through familiar regional grapes and a quiet, rural setting.
